Latest revision as of 15:17, 2 November 2011
On the back-end there is a Medication Allergy dictionary. This dictionary is not visible via TW Admin or SSMT. Most entries in the Medication Allergy dictionary are linked to the corresponding Medication dictionary entries, but not all. The ones that aren’t linked are too generic, like “ACE Inhibitors”. Clients can request additions to this dictionary via SupportForce.
FYI: non-med allergies can be added to the 'Allergen' dictionary accessable via TWAdmin > Dictionaries
